Ancient Era
The ancient era spans thousands of years and includes civilizations like the Egyptians, Greeks, Romans, and Mesopotamians. These ancient societies laid the foundation for art, architecture, philosophy, and governance, leaving behind iconic landmarks like the Pyramids of Giza and the Acropolis.

Medieval Era
The medieval era, characterized by knights, castles, and feudalism, witnessed the rise of powerful empires like the Byzantines, the Holy Roman Empire, and the Mongols. This period also saw significant developments in trade, religion, and the arts, with events like the Crusades leaving a lasting impact on European and Middle Eastern history.

Age of Exploration
The Age of Exploration, starting in the 15th century, was marked by European voyages to discover new lands and establish trade routes. Explorers like Christopher Columbus, Vasco da Gama, and Ferdinand Magellan embarked on daring journeys that expanded the known world and led to the Columbian Exchange, a significant exchange of goods, ideas, and cultures between the Old World and the New World.

Industrial Revolution
The Industrial Revolution, beginning in the 18th century, brought about a period of rapid industrialization, urbanization, and technological advancements. Inventions like the steam engine, spinning jenny, and telegraph revolutionized production, transportation, and communication, leading to profound social and economic changes.

World Wars
The 20th century witnessed two devastating World Wars that reshaped global politics, alliances, and boundaries. World War I, known as the Great War, and World War II, marked by the rise of totalitarian regimes and the horrors of the Holocaust, brought about unprecedented destruction and loss of life, leading to the establishment of international organizations like the United Nations to promote peace and cooperation.
